Tap into valuable local knowledge for a bushwalk towards Wonangatta Station. Explore the path of an original bridal trail and discover the fascinating, gold-flecked history hidden in the Victorian High Country.

Segment Highlights:

  • Stand on the actual footprint of the original 4-foot bridal trail that led to Wonangatta.
  • Learn about the area’s Gold Rush past and the quartz reefs the old prospectors searched.
  • Visit an incredible historic trestle bridge built by miners to cross the flooded Crooked River.
